10가지 최고의 OpenAPI 문서 도구 (무료 및 유료)

오늘은 시장에서 가장 인기 있는 10가지 OpenAPI 문서화 도구를 소개하고, 그들의 기능, 사용성, 장점 및 한계에 대한 통찰력을 제공하겠습니다. 이러한 옵션을 탐색함으로써 귀하의 프로젝트와 팀에 가장 적합한 도구를 선택할 수 있습니다.

Young-jae

Young-jae

20 December 2024

10가지 최고의 OpenAPI 문서 도구 (무료 및 유료)

OpenAPI는 API를 구축하고 문서화하기 위한 사양입니다. RESTful API를 설명하는 표준 방법을 제공하여 개발자가 이를 이해하고 소비하는 데 용이하게 합니다. 엔드포인트, 요청/응답 형식, 매개변수 등을 정의함으로써 OpenAPI는 API 개발을 단순화하고 시스템 간의 상호 운용성을 향상시킵니다.

수동으로 API 문서를 작성하는 것에 비해 OpenAPI 문서를 생성하는 도구를 선택하는 것은 많은 개발자에게 효과적이고 효율적인 방법입니다. 이러한 도구는 API 문서를 생성, 업데이트 및 유지 관리하는 프로세스를 간소화하여 시간을 절약하고 오류 발생 가능성을 줄입니다.

오늘은 시장에서 가장 좋은 10개의 OpenAPI 문서화 도구를 소개하며, 각 도구의 기능, 사용성, 장점 및 한계에 대한 통찰력을 제공합니다. 사용자 경험, 맞춤형 옵션 또는 협업 기능을 우선시하든, 이 목록에 있는 도구 중에서 귀하의 필요에 적합한 도구를 찾을 수 있습니다.

API 문서화 도구를 사용해야 하는 이유는 무엇인가요?

RESTful API를 정의하는 표준을 마스터하면 API를 관리하고 유지하기 위해 OpenAPI 문서화 도구가 필요할 수 있습니다. OpenAPI 도구를 사용하면 여러 가지 주요 이점이 있습니다:

상위 10개 OpenAPI 문서화 도구 목록

다음으로, 사용법, 장점 및 단점을 포함하여 10개의 최고의 OpenAPI 문서화 도구를 살펴보겠습니다. 이러한 옵션을 탐색함으로써 프로젝트와 팀에 가장 적합한 도구를 선택하여 원활한 API 개발과 애플리케이션과의 매끄러운 통합을 보장할 수 있습니다. 이 게시물이 귀하의 필요에 맞는 최고의 OpenAPI 문서 생성기를 찾는 데 도움이 되기를 바랍니다.

Apidog

Apidog는 API 문서화 프로세스를 효율적으로 만들기 위해 설계된 다목적 OpenAPI 문서 도구입니다. 사용자 친화적인 인터페이스와 사용자 정의 가능한 테마 및 레이아웃을 제공하여 개발자가 철저한 API 문서를 손쉽게 작성할 수 있도록 합니다.

Apidog는 다양한 프로그래밍 언어 및 프레임워크를 지원하여 다양한 개발 환경에 적응할 수 있습니다. 강력한 기능 중에는 인터랙티브 API 테스트, 코드 샘플 생성 및 실시간 협업이 포함되어 있어 생산성을 높이고 팀 구성원 간의 효과적인 커뮤니케이션을 촉진합니다.

Apidog

장점:

단점:

Swagger UI

Swagger UI는 전 세계 개발자에게 신뢰받는 유명한 OpenAPI 문서 도구입니다. Swagger UI는 API 문서를 시각적으로 확인하고 상호작용할 수 있는 깔끔하고 직관적인 인터페이스를 제공합니다.

반면에 SwaggerHub는 API를 공동으로 설계, 문서화 및 관리하기 위한 중앙 집중식 플랫폼을 제공합니다. 두 도구 모두 OpenAPI 사양을 지원하여 기존 API 및 서비스와의 원활한 통합을 가능하게 합니다. 코드 생성, API 모킹 및 버전 관리와 같은 기능을 통해 Swagger UI는 팀이 API 개발을 가속화하고 프로젝트 간의 일관성을 보장하도록 지원합니다.

장점:

단점:

Postman

Postman은 강력한 문서화 기능이 포함된 종합적인 API 개발 플랫폼입니다. API 클라이언트로서의 기본 기능을 넘어 Postman은 API를 생성, 테스트 및 문서화하는 기능을 제공합니다. 문서화 기능을 통해 사용자는 포괄적인 API 문서를 손쉽게 생성하고 게시할 수 있습니다.

Postman은 OpenAPI 사양과 RAML을 모두 지원하여 기존 API 사양과 원활하게 통합됩니다. 자동 문서 생성, 인터랙티브 예제 및 팀 협업 도구와 같은 기능을 통해 Postman은 API 문서를 생성하고 유지 관리하는 프로세스를 단순화하여 개발자의 생산성을 높이고 개발 팀 내의 효과적인 커뮤니케이션을 촉진합니다.

장점:

단점:

Apiary

Apiary는 개발자가 단순함과 효율성으로 신뢰하는 인기 있는 API 문서 도구입니다. API 설계, 문서화 및 테스트를 위한 협업 플랫폼을 제공하여 팀이 API 개발 주기를 간소화할 수 있도록 지원합니다.

Apiary

Apiary의 문서화 기능을 통해 사용자는 API Blueprint, Swagger 또는 RAML 파일에서 인터랙티브 API 문서를 생성할 수 있습니다. 직관적인 편집기와 사용자 정의 가능한 테마 덕분에 특정 프로젝트 요구 사항을 충족하는 시각적으로 매력적인 문서를 쉽게 만들 수 있습니다. API 모킹, 자동화된 테스트 및 버전 관리 통합과 같은 기능을 통해 Apiary는 팀이 신속하게 반복 작업을 수행하고 고품질 API를 제공할 수 있도록 합니다.

장점:

단점:

ReDoc

ReDoc는 단순함과 우아함으로 잘 알려진 강력한 OpenAPI 문서 도구입니다. 최소한의 구성으로 아름답고 반응적인 API 문서를 생성하는 데 중점을 둡니다. ReDoc은 OpenAPI 사양 파일에서 인터랙티브 API 문서를 자동으로 생성하여 개발자가 API를 탐색하고 테스트하는 원활한 경험을 제공합니다. 사용자 정의 가능한 테마와 레이아웃 옵션을 통해 사용자는 문서를 구체적인 요구에 맞게 조정할 수 있으며, Markdown 지원을 통해 추가 콘텐츠의 쉬운 통합이 가능합니다. ReDoc은 최소한의 설정으로 시각적으로 매력적인 API 문서를 신속하게 작성하려는 팀에 탁월한 선택입니다.

장점:

단점:

DapperDox

DapperDox는 포괄적인 API 문서 생성을 효율적이게 하고자 설계된 기능이 풍부한 OpenAPI 문서 도구입니다. 광범위한 사용자 정의 옵션을 제공하여 개발자가 문서를 특정 요구 사항에 맞게 조정할 수 있습니다. DapperDox는 HTML, Markdown 및 PDF를 포함한 다양한 출력 형식을 지원하여 문서가 어떻게 제시되고 공유되는지에 대한 유연성을 제공합니다. 인터랙티브 API 테스트, 코드 샘플 생성 및 버전 관리 통합과 같은 기능을 통해 DapperDox는 팀이 효과적으로 협력하고 API 개발 프로세스를 가속화할 수 있도록 돕습니다.

장점:

단점:

Theneo

Theneo는 API 문서 생성 및 관리를 단순화하도록 설계된 다목적 OpenAPI 문서 도구입니다. 직관적인 제어로 사용자 친화적인 인터페이스를 제공하여 모든 수준의 개발자가 접근할 수 있습니다. Theneo는 실시간 협업을 지원하여 팀원들이 API 문서화 작업을 원활하게 함께 진행할 수 있게 합니다. 자동 엔드포인트 감지, 인터랙티브 API 테스트 및 사용자 정의 가능한 템플릿과 같은 기능을 통해 Theneo는 문서화 프로세스를 간소화하고 전반적인 생산성을 향상시킵니다.

장점:

단점:

Hoppsoctch

Hoppsoctch는 API 테스트 및 디버깅 프로세스를 단순화하도록 설계된 현대적인 API 개발 도구입니다. HTTP 요청을 보내고 응답을 검사하는 데 사용자 친화적인 인터페이스를 제공하여 API와 자주 상호작용해야 하는 개발자에게 이상적인 선택입니다.

Hoppsoctch는 다양한 인증 방법을 지원하며 사용자가 요청을 저장하고 조직하여 나중에 사용할 수 있도록 합니다. 환경 변수, 응답 모킹 및 스크립팅 지원과 같은 기능을 통해 Hoppsoctch는 개발자의 생산성을 향상시키고 효율적인 API 테스트 및 디버깅 프로세스를 촉진합니다.

장점:

단점:

ReadMe

ReadMe는 기업이 개발자 친화적인 API 문서를 생성하고 유지하는 데 도움을 주기 위해 설계된 종합적인 API 문서 플랫폼입니다. 인터랙티브 API 참고 가이드, 코드 샘플 및 SDK 생성을 포함하여 API 문서를 문서화하는 데 필요한 다양한 기능을 제공합니다.

ReadMe의 직관적인 편집기를 사용하면 사용자가 문서를 쉽게 생성하고 사용자화할 수 있으며, 내장된 버전 관리 및 협업 도구는 팀워크를 촉진하고 문서 일관성을 보장합니다. API 분석, 개발자 포털 및 API 탐색기와 같은 기능을 통해 ReadMe는 조직이 원활한 개발자 경험을 제공하고 API에 대한 커뮤니티 참여를 촉진할 수 있습니다.

장점:

단점:

Stoplight

Stoplight는 팀이 전체 API 생애주기를 간소화할 수 있도록 돕는 다목적 API 설계 및 문서화 플랫폼입니다. API를 설계, 문서화, 모킹 및 테스트하는 기능을 제공하여 API 개발 요구 사항에 대한 원스톱 솔루션을 제공합니다. Stoplight의 비주얼 편집기를 사용하면 사용자가 OpenAPI 사양 또는 JSON 스키마를 사용하여 협업하여 API를 설계할 수 있습니다.

Stoplight

문서화 기능을 통해 사용자는 코드 예제 및 API 탐색기를 포함하여 인터랙티브 API 문서를 손쉽게 생성할 수 있습니다. API 모킹, 자동화된 테스트 및 버전 관리 통합과 같은 기능을 통해 Stoplight는 팀이 신속하게 반복하고 비즈니스 요구 사항을 충족하는 고품질 API를 제공할 수 있도록 지원합니다.

장점:

단점:

OpenAPI 문서 생성기 FAQ

OpenAPI와 Swagger 사이의 관계는 무엇인가요?

OpenAPI와 Swagger의 관계는 Swagger가 결국 OpenAPI 사양(OAS)으로 발전한 API 사양의 원래 이름이라는 것입니다.

Swagger는 처음에 Tony Tam에 의해 Wordnik에서 개발되었으며, 이후 Linux Foundation의 OpenAPI Initiative에 기부되었습니다. Swagger 사양은 이제 RESTful API를 정의하는 산업 표준이 된 OpenAPI 사양의 기초를 형성하였습니다.

Swagger는 문서화 도구인가요?

네, Swagger는 API 문서화 도구이자 API를 설계, 구축 및 문서화하기 위한 프레임워크입니다.

Swagger는 단순한 문서화 도구 이상입니다; 이는 API 개발 및 문서화를 위한 포괄적인 프레임워크입니다. 그 주요 기능은 OpenAPI 사양 파일에서 인터랙티브하고 사용자 친화적인 API 문서를 생성하는 것이지만, Swagger는 또한 API 설계, 테스트 및 구현을 지원하는 다양한 기능을 제공합니다.

Explore more

2025년에 알아야 할 최고의 10가지 비주얼 테스트 도구

2025년에 알아야 할 최고의 10가지 비주얼 테스트 도구

웹 앱이 모든 기기에서 완벽하게 보이는지 확인하기 위한 최고의 비주얼 테스트 도구를 찾고 계신가요? Applitools, Percy 등 상위 10개 비주얼 테스트 도구에 대한 가이드를 확인해 보세요. 이 강력한 도구들로 테스트 워크플로를 향상시켜 보세요.

18 December 2024

원활한 사용자 경험을 위한 최고의 10개 이상의 사용성 테스트 도구

원활한 사용자 경험을 위한 최고의 10개 이상의 사용성 테스트 도구

UX 최적화를 위한 상위 10개 사용성 테스트 도구를 확인하세요! API 중심의 혁신적인 업데이트를 제공하는 Apidog부터 히트맵 기능을 가진 Hotjar까지. 이러한 도구가 사용자 피드백 수집을 간소화하고 제품 디자인을 개선하는 방법을 살펴보세요!

17 December 2024

2025년을 위한 Mac용 최고의 API 테스트 도구: 추천 목록

2025년을 위한 Mac용 최고의 API 테스트 도구: 추천 목록

API 테스트는 소프트웨어 개발에 중요합니다. 2025년에는 Mac 사용자가 Apidog, Postman, Paw와 같은 최고의 도구에 접근할 수 있습니다. 이 가이드는 20개의 API 테스트 도구를 검토하며, 기능, 가격 및 장점을 강조하여 최적의 도구를 선택하는 데 도움을 줍니다.

16 December 2024

Apidog에서 API 설계-첫 번째 연습

API를 더 쉽게 구축하고 사용하는 방법을 발견하세요